Health and Wellness Gadgets That Transform Your Daily Routine

Smart sleep tracking rings that optimize your rest cycles
Sleep tracking rings represent one of the most innovative health and wellness tech advances you probably haven't heard of yet. Unlike bulky smartwatches, these lightweight rings sit comfortably on your finger and monitor your sleep patterns with incredible precision. The Oura Ring and newer models like the Ultrahuman Ring Air use advanced sensors to track heart rate variability, body temperature, and movement throughout the night.
What makes these smart gadgets 2024 standouts special is their ability to analyze your sleep stages and provide personalized recommendations. They detect when you enter deep sleep, REM cycles, and light sleep phases, then offer insights on optimal bedtimes and wake-up windows. Some models even vibrate gently during your lightest sleep phase within a 30-minute window of your alarm, ensuring you wake up feeling refreshed rather than groggy.
The battery life typically lasts 4-7 days, and the accompanying apps create detailed sleep scores and trends. Many users discover they're getting less restorative sleep than they thought, leading to simple lifestyle changes that dramatically improve their energy levels.
Portable air quality monitors for cleaner breathing spaces
Indoor air quality affects your health more than most people realize, making portable air quality monitors some of the coolest gadgets for home use. These compact devices detect pollutants, allergens,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and particulate matter in real-time. Popular models like the AirThings Wave Plus and IQAir AirVisual monitor everything from radon levels to humidity.
The beauty of these devices lies in their portability - you can move them between rooms, take them to your office, or even pack them for travel. They connect to smartphone apps that send alerts when air quality drops and suggest actions like opening windows or turning on air purifiers. Some advanced models integrate with smart home systems to automatically trigger air purification when needed.
Many users are shocked to discover that their "clean" homes actually have poor air quality due to cooking fumes, cleaning products, or inadequate ventilation. These monitors help identify problem areas and times, allowing you to make targeted improvements that can reduce allergies, improve sleep, and boost overall wellness.
UV sterilizing phone cases that eliminate 99% of germs
Your phone harbors more bacteria than most toilet seats, making UV sterilizing cases brilliant health and wellness tech solutions. These cases use UV-C light technology to eliminate 99.9% of germs, bacteria, and viruses from your phone's surface in just minutes. Brands like PhoneSoap and Lexon have created sleek designs that don't compromise your phone's functionality.
The sterilization process typically takes 10-15 minutes and works while your phone charges. Many models include wireless charging capabilities and can accommodate phones with cases on. Some advanced versions even sterilize other small items like earbuds, keys, or jewelry.

Smart posture correctors that prevent back pain
Smart posture correctors go far beyond traditional braces by using sensors and gentle vibrations to train better posture habits. Devices like the Upright Go and Lumo Lift attach discretely to your back or shoulder and monitor your posture throughout the day. When you slouch or lean forward, they provide gentle vibration reminders to straighten up.
These innovative gadgets you didn't know existed use accelerometers and gyroscopes to detect position changes and track improvement over time. The companion apps show daily posture scores, sitting vs. standing time, and progress toward better alignment. Many allow you to set "training sessions" where reminders are active, gradually building muscle memory for proper posture.
What's remarkable is how quickly users see improvements. Within weeks, many people develop unconscious habits of maintaining better posture even without the device. This leads to reduced back pain, increased energy, and improved confidence. Physical therapists often recommend these devices as supplements to traditional treatment, and office workers find them invaluable for combating the effects of desk jobs.
The discrete design means you can wear them under clothes without anyone noticing, making them practical for professional settings. Some models offer different sensitivity levels and reminder frequencies, allowing you to customize the experience based on your needs and comfort level.
Kitchen Innovation Gadgets That Save Time and Money
Intelligent herb gardens that grow fresh ingredients indoors
Gone are the days of wilted grocery store herbs sitting forgotten in your fridge. These innovative gadgets you didn't know existed are revolutionizing how home cooks access fresh ingredients year-round. Smart indoor herb gardens combine LED grow lights, automated watering systems, and nutrient delivery to create the perfect growing environment right on your countertop.
The AeroGarden series leads the pack with models that can grow up to 12 different herbs simultaneously. These systems use hydroponic technology, meaning no soil mess and faster growth rates than traditional gardening. You simply insert pre-seeded pods, add water and nutrients, and watch basil, cilantro, parsley, and thyme flourish under full-spectrum LED lights.
What makes these kitchen innovation gadgets truly smart is their app connectivity. Your phone alerts you when water levels drop or when it's time to harvest. Some models even provide recipe suggestions based on what's growing in your garden. The Click & Grow Smart Garden takes automation further by using NASA-inspired growing technology that automatically adjusts light cycles and delivers precise nutrients.
For smaller spaces, the Plantui Smart Garden fits perfectly in studio apartments while still producing restaurant-quality herbs. These gardens typically pay for themselves within 3-4 months compared to buying fresh herbs at the grocery store, making them both a time-saver and money-saver.

Ultrasonic vegetable washers that remove pesticides naturally
Washing vegetables with water alone removes only surface dirt, leaving behind pesticide residues that regular scrubbing can't eliminate. Ultrasonic vegetable washers use high-frequency sound waves to create microscopic bubbles that penetrate deep into produce, naturally removing chemicals without harsh detergents.
The Sonic Soak device fits in any bowl and generates 50,000 ultrasonic vibrations per second. These vibrations create cavitation bubbles that implode against vegetable surfaces, dislodging pesticides, bacteria, and dirt from even the tiniest crevices. Testing shows these devices remove up to 99% more contaminants than traditional washing methods.
Larger countertop models like the Crosslee Ultrasonic Cleaner can handle bigger batches of produce. Fill the basin with water, add your vegetables, and run a 5-10 minute cleaning cycle. The ultrasonic action works on everything from delicate berries to root vegetables with tough skins. Many models include different frequency settings optimized for various produce types.
These washers extend the shelf life of cleaned vegetables by removing bacteria that cause spoilage. Strawberries cleaned ultrasonically often last twice as long as those washed conventionally. While the initial investment ranges from $50-300 depending on size, the health benefits and reduced food waste make these hidden gem tech products worthwhile additions to any health-conscious kitchen.
The technology requires no chemicals, making it safe for organic produce and environmentally friendly compared to commercial vegetable wash products.
Home Security Gadgets Beyond Traditional Cameras

Smart Door Locks with Facial Recognition Technology
Modern home security gadgets have evolved beyond basic keypads and traditional locks. Smart door locks equipped with facial recognition technology represent a breakthrough in residential security. These devices scan and memorize your facial features, automatically unlocking when you approach. The technology works even in low-light conditions thanks to infrared sensors.
Top models like the Yale Nest x Yale Lock and August Smart Lock Pro feature multiple authentication methods - facial recognition, smartphone apps, and backup PIN codes. They send real-time notifications when someone accesses your home and maintain detailed logs of entry attempts. Installation typically takes 30 minutes without rewiring, making them perfect for renters and homeowners alike.
Window Vibration Sensors That Detect Break-in Attempts
These innovative gadgets you didn't know existed attach discreetly to window frames and detect the specific vibration patterns of breaking glass or forced entry attempts. Unlike motion sensors that trigger after someone's already inside, vibration sensors alert you the moment an intrusion begins.
The SimpliSafe Glassbreak Sensor and Ring Alarm Glass Break Sensor use advanced algorithms to distinguish between normal household sounds and actual break-in attempts. They connect wirelessly to your home security system and can differentiate between a ball hitting a window versus intentional glass breaking. Battery life extends up to 3 years, and installation requires no tools or professional help.

Fake TV Simulators That Deter Burglars When You're Away
The FakeTV device mimics the light patterns and color changes of a real television, creating the impression someone's home watching TV. This clever security gadget costs a fraction of actual home automation systems while providing effective deterrence. Studies show that homes appearing occupied are 50% less likely to be targeted by burglars.
The device features 12 different scenes replicating various TV content - from news broadcasts to action movies. It automatically activates at dusk and runs for 4-7 hours, powered by a simple wall adapter. The compact design fits on windowsills or shelves, visible from outside but inconspicuous indoors.
Smart Smoke Detectors with Smartphone Integration
Next-generation smoke detectors go beyond traditional beeping alarms. The Nest Protect and First Alert Onelink Safe & Sound provide smartphone notifications when smoke or carbon monoxide is detected, even when you're away. They distinguish between cooking smoke and actual fires, reducing false alarms by up to 80%.
These smart gadgets 2024 feature voice alerts that specify the type and location of danger - "Smoke in the kitchen" rather than generic beeping. Built-in night lights provide gentle illumination, and some models include Amazon Alexa integration for additional smart home functionality. Professional monitoring services can automatically contact emergency responders when dangerous levels are detected.

Universal Travel Adapters with Fast Charging Capabilities
Modern universal adapters have evolved far beyond simple plug converters. Today's unique tech gadgets in this category pack serious charging power into compact designs that work in virtually every country worldwide.
The newest generation includes GaN (Gallium Nitride) technology, allowing multiple high-speed charging ports in surprisingly small packages. A single adapter can simultaneously charge laptops, tablets, phones, and other devices at optimal speeds - something that would have required multiple chargers just a few years ago.
Key features that make these adapters essential:
-
65W-100W power delivery for laptop charging
-
Multiple USB-C and USB-A ports (typically 4-6 total)
-
Built-in surge protection for expensive electronics
-
Compact folding design that fits easily in carry-on bags
-
LED indicators showing charging status and power levels
Top-rated models like the Anker PowerPort III and EPICKA Universal Travel Adapter support fast charging protocols for all major device brands. They automatically detect connected devices and deliver optimal charging speeds, making them indispensable for travelers carrying multiple electronics.
These adapters eliminate the need to pack multiple chargers and ensure your devices stay powered no matter where your adventures take you.

Wireless bone conduction headphones for active lifestyles
Experience music without blocking your ears using bone conduction technology that transmits sound through vibrations in your skull. These entertainment gadgets allow you to stay aware of your surroundings while enjoying crystal-clear audio during workouts, cycling, or outdoor adventures. Professional athletes and fitness enthusiasts love them because they don't interfere with spatial awareness or cause ear fatigue during extended use.
The latest bone conduction headphones offer 8-hour battery life, IPX8 waterproofing, and noise-canceling microphones for calls. They're lighter than traditional headphones and won't slip off during intense activities. Some models include built-in storage for music, eliminating the need to carry your phone during runs or gym sessions.
